Output b03d4a8c6aedcdd686e0d86fb60cdb84c576a24276bf2fd81af590292e2d9ace:0

value
76566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65d5f696b2d4923168cb09e84de47f827238f2e OP_EQUAL
address
3Nh5CKA2CUa4ZwM3vciRZb8NVGYoV7GRKy
transaction
b03d4a8c6aedcdd686e0d86fb60cdb84c576a24276bf2fd81af590292e2d9ace
confirmations
304981
spent
true